WebJun 30, 2024 · California employees working a minimum of 30 days a year can receive paid sick leave and can use accrued hours toward it after working for an employer for at least 90 days. Workers accrue one hour of leave for every 30 hours, which carries over from year to year, but a business can cap it at 48 hours or six days if it so chooses. WebPer California Code of Regulations, title 2, section 599.746 after the completion of each qualifying pay period, each full-time employee shall be allowed one day credit for sick leave with pay. Per California Code of Regulations, title 2, section 599.608 a qualifying pay period means an employee must have 11 or more working days of service in a ...
